Commentary from Pastor Michael White:
And He said, “Hagar, Sarai’s maid, where have you come from, and where are you going?” She said, “I am fleeing from the presence of my mistress Sarai.” The Angel of the Lord said to her, “Return to your mistress, and submit yourself under her hand.” – Gen. 16:8-9

Many of us are tempted to run when we face conflict. “I should just quit,” we say about our job. “I should just walk out,” we think about our marriage. But the easy answer is not always the right answer. Sarah despised Hagar, so Hagar ran away! But the Angel of the Lord met Hagar as she fled. “Return to your mistress,” He told her, “and submit yourself under her hand.”

When life gets tough and unfair, the answer is not always to run! For Hagar, the answer was to return. God wanted Hagar to go back to Sarah, even though Sarah despised her; and as she did, God would bless her beyond her wildest dreams!

God may ask you to walk away. Or, He may tell you to return. But let Him decide what to do, because He alone knows the way.
